FRENCH BREAD PIZZA CAPRESE
253 Cals 12 Protein 33 Carbs 9 Fats
TOTAL TIME:
10 mins
YIELD:4 SERVINGS
COURSE:Dinner, Lunch
CUISINE:Italian
I”ve been taking advantage of the tomatoes and basil overflowing from my garden with these simple French bread pizzas. Only 5 ingredients, less than 10 minutes to make!
INGREDIENTS
8 oz whole wheat French bread baguette
4 oz fresh mozzarella cheese, sliced thin
2 medium tomatoes, sliced thin
1 tbsp balsamic glaze
1 tbsp fresh basil, chopped
INSTRUCTIONS
Cut the bread in half lengthwise, then cut each half crosswise in 2 pieces to give you 4 pieces total. Tear the the cheese into pieces and place on top of the bread.
Place under the broiler or toaster oven until the cheese melts, about 2 to 3 minutes.
Remove from oven, top with tomatoes, drizzle with balsamic and finish with fresh basil.
